diff options
Diffstat (limited to 'database.test.c')
-rw-r--r-- | database.test.c |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/database.test.c b/database.test.c index 12377db..5afb043 100644 --- a/database.test.c +++ b/database.test.c @@ -3,18 +3,19 @@ #include <stdlib.h> #include <stdio.h> +#include <time.h> // You've really fucking done it now, Mark. // Not impressed. -const static char* SAMPLE_PATH = "features/facebook-crypto-currency"; +const static char* SAMPLE_PATH = "features-facebook-crypto-currency"; int databasePutGetTest() { + int size = 1024; struct TimeEnty_t input = { .direction = IN, .datetime = time(NULL) }; struct TimeEnty_t output[1024]; - int size = 1024; database_pushEntry(SAMPLE_PATH, &input); database_getEntries(SAMPLE_PATH, output, &size); if(size != 1) { @@ -26,8 +27,10 @@ int databasePutGetTest() { if(output[0].datetime != input.datetime) { goto fail; } + database_nuke(SAMPLE_PATH); return 0; fail: + database_nuke(SAMPLE_PATH); return -1; } |